Two mysterious deaths in the center of Rome, apparently unconnected to each other, shake the heart of Christianity: a lawyer is murdered near Castel Sant'Angelo and a university professor, engaged in Artificial Intelligence development, dies under suspicious circumstances.
Vatican Veil is a spy thriller set between Rome, London and China, in which four brilliant university students find themselves involved in an investigation that leads them to discover a delicate international web larger than themselves. The Vatican and China - two very distant worlds - seem to have common interests, whose implications could change global geopolitical balances. While British secret services try to shed light on the mysteries, the crucial role of a sophisticated Artificial Intelligence emerges that could reveal truths buried in time. In a crescendo of tension, the protagonists move through the shadows of a contemporary Rome that is always ready to shuffle the cards, where nothing is as it seems and every answer leads to new questions.
Giuliano Zorloni builds a compelling and extremely current plot by weaving together elements of technological espionage, geopolitics and thriller in a story that explores the complex relationships between power, technology and international diplomacy.
